Mold Remediation and Removal in Marieville, Quebec

Mold is a type of fungus that exists inherently in the environment, playing an important ecological role in breaking down dead organic matter outdoors. However, when mold takes hold inside homes and commercial buildings, it becomes a significant threat to both human health and structural integrity. Mold reproduces by spreading microscopic spores that float through the air, undetectable, until they land on surfaces with sufficient moisture and organic material to support growth. Once established, a mold colony can spread rapidly, often appearing behind walls, beneath flooring, and inside HVAC systems where it remains hidden until major damage has already occurred.

The health risks associated with indoor mold exposure are well documented by medical researchers and public health authorities. Mold spores act as potent allergens, triggering symptoms including nasal congestion, eye irritation, skin rashes, and respiratory distress in vulnerable individuals. People with asthma often experience worsening symptoms and more frequent attacks when living or working in mold-contaminated environments. Certain mold species, particularly Stachybotrys chartarum, commonly called black mold, produce mycotoxins that can cause more serious health effects including chronic fatigue, persistent headaches, and neurological symptoms. Children, elderly individuals, and those with weakened immune systems face higher risks from mold exposure, making prompt professional remediation critical for protecting vulnerable household members.

Beyond health concerns, mold actively destroys the materials that form your propertys structure. Mold feeds on cellulose-based materials including wood framing, drywall paper, ceiling tiles, and carpet backing, breaking down these components as it grows. Left untreated, mold contamination can compromise load-bearing structural elements, require major rebuilding rather than simple cleaning, and significantly reduce property values in Marieville, Quebecs competitive real estate market. The financial impact of postponed remediation almost always exceeds the cost of addressing mold contamination quickly and professionally.

Many property owners wonder whether they can handle mold cleanup themselves using consumer products available at local hardware stores. While small surface mold patches on non-porous materials may be manageable with proper precautions, attempting DIY remediation on extensive mold growth typically makes the problem worse. Disturbing established mold colonies without proper containment spreads enormous quantities of spores into the air, contaminating previously unaffected areas throughout your property. Consumer-grade cleaning products cannot reach porous materials where mold roots itself, leaving hidden growth that quickly returns after surface cleaning. Professional mold remediation involves specialized containment barriers, commercial-grade air filtration, and thorough removal of contaminated materials that DIY approaches simply cannot replicate.

Understanding what causes mold growth in properties across Marieville, Quebec helps homeowners and business owners identify conditions requiring professional attention. Common causes of mold contamination include:

  • Leaking pipes inside walls that create persistent moisture invisible from living spaces
  • High humidity in basements or crawl spaces where air circulation is limited
  • Storm and flood damage common in Marieville, Quebec during severe weather seasons
  • Poor attic ventilation trapping moisture and condensation near roof structures
  • HVAC condensation issues creating wet conditions in ductwork and air handling equipment
  • Wet insulation from roof leaks or exterior water intrusion
  • Foundation moisture from improper grading or failed waterproofing systems

Step 3: Containment Using Professional Barriers

Before disturbing any mold growth, our technicians set up professional containment barriers to isolate the contaminated area from the rest of your property. Mold remediation by nature disturbs established colonies, releasing massive quantities of spores that would quickly spread contamination throughout your home without proper containment. Our containment protocols stop spores from spreading, safeguarding clean spaces and minimizing the overall scope of remediation required.

Containment begins with sealing all doorways, vents, and openings connecting the work area to other spaces using thick plastic barriers and specialized tape. We install negative pressure systems that create negative pressure within the contained space, ensuring that any air leakage flows inward rather than outward, preventing spores from escaping into clean areas. Technicians working within containment wear full personal protective equipment including respirators, disposable coveralls, and gloves to prevent both personal exposure and spore transport on clothing.

Warning signs and physical barriers keep unauthorized entry from occurring by occupants, staff, or pets during active remediation. This containment phase typically requires several hours to establish properly but represents one of the most critical investments in successful mold remediation for properties throughout Marieville, Quebec.

Step 4: HEPA Filtration and Air Scrubbing

Air quality management represents a core component of certified mold remediation that sets apart our services from DIY cleanup attempts. Throughout the remediation process, we operate commercial HEPA air filtration devices, commonly called air scrubbers, that continuously filter air within the containment zone. HEPA filters capture particles as small as microscopic sizes with 99.97% efficiency, effectively removing mold spores from the air before they can resettle or escape containment.

Our air scrubbing equipment operates around the clock during all remediation activities and often continues running for additional time after active work concludes to remove residual airborne spores. Can mold be cleaned without professional help?

This is one of the most common questions from homeowners and business owners in Marieville, Quebec is whether they can handle mold themselves. The answer depends on the extent and location of the mold contamination. Minor mold spots on non-porous surfaces like tile, glass, or metal can sometimes be removed safely using appropriate precautions, including masks, gloves, and adequate ventilation.
However, mold larger than 10 sq. ft., any mold on porous materials like drywall or carpet, mold in hidden areas such as behind walls or under flooring, or mold caused by sewage or water damage necessitates professional remediation.
Attempting to clean significant mold growth without industry-standard containment and proper tools can spread spores throughout your property, escalating a small issue into a widespread problem. Additionally, household cleaners cannot reach deep into absorbent surfaces where mold establishes, meaning surface cleaning leaves hidden growth that returns.
Professional remediation provides containment, air filtration, thorough material removal, and antimicrobial treatment, ensuring a lasting solution. How can I identify black mold?

Many property owners worry about black mold, scientifically known as Stachybotrys chartarum, are common among homeowners who discover mold growth. However, visually identifying black mold is not as simple as it seems. While Stachybotrys typically appears black or dark green with a distinctive slimy texture when wet, many other common mold species, including Cladosporium and Aspergillus, can also appear similar in color. Conversely, black mold can sometimes appear grayish or greenish depending on conditions and age.


The only definitive way to confirm the exact species is through lab testing of samples collected from your property. If you are worried specifically about Stachybotrys, Harper Mold Services can take samples during our assessment and submit them to certified laboratories for species identification.

Does mold have a noticeable smell?

In many cases, the first sign of mold is a distinct odor that property owners frequently detect before seeing visible contamination. Mold metabolic processes release volatile organic compounds that create musty, earthy, or stale odors frequently compared to wet cardboard, damp wood, or rotting leaves. These odors can be stronger during humid weather when mold is most active and may be most noticeable in areas with limited airflow such as basements, closets, or attics.


Importantly, a musty smell without obvious mold often signals concealed mold growth behind walls, beneath flooring, or in other concealed spaces. Is mold removal covered by insurance in Marieville, Quebec?

Coverage for mold cleanup varies significantly depending on your specific policy, the cause of mold growth, and how your insurer handles claims. Most homeowners policies in Marieville, Quebec cover mold remediation when contamination results from a covered peril such as burst pipes, storm damage, or malfunctioning appliances. However, mold resulting from ongoing maintenance issues like persistent plumbing problems, inadequate airflow, or neglected humidity problems may not be covered because it is considered avoidable through routine care.

The records submitted with your claim plays a critical role in coverage decisions. Can mold spread to other parts of the property?

Mold absolutely spreads throughout properties when conditions allow, which is why prompt professional remediation is so important. Mold spreads through tiny spores that move through the air, ventilation systems, and can hitch a ride on clothing, shoes, and pets. Once these spores settle on moist, organic surfaces, new colonies establish and begin growing. A localized mold issue can spread throughout your home in a short time if moisture sources arent addressed.

Disturbing mold growth without proper containment dramatically accelerates spread.
